Sisters sell lemonade to pay off classmates’ school lunch debt
DAVIDSON COUNTY. N.C. – Two young girls are hoping to make a difference in their classmates’ lives with a lemonade stand. Sisters Hailey and Hannah Hager spent the weekend squeezing and serving lemonade to raise money for their peers at Southwood Elementary in Lexington. Student lunch debt at the school is up to $3,100. “There’s one family that owes $800,” Erin Hager, the girls’mom, told WGHP. “I don’t know how many years’ worth that is, but it’s a big deal.” […]...
